Transaction dd3c3f82d3b718c426d4e50b0b67386fa35825fd35cfaeae6818e50e08dfae4a
1 Input
2 Outputs
- dd3c3f82d3b718c426d4e50b0b67386fa35825fd35cfaeae6818e50e08dfae4a:0
- dd3c3f82d3b718c426d4e50b0b67386fa35825fd35cfaeae6818e50e08dfae4a:1
value 175072
address 3MCPix1FPmiF4piWiZaNDHRm1nBNr2Vgka
value 562302488
address 1G4Y8DttyG6d8kPBweURM47tyebbSXjWLS